Historic Religious Sites

Greater Poland serves as the cradle of the Polish state, a history reflected in its diverse religious architecture. This collection includes the Gniezno Cathedral, the coronation site of early Polish kings, and the ornate Baroque Poznań Fara. The list spans from the Cistercian Ląd Abbey to Gothic brick churches in Koło and Szamotuły, showcasing architectural styles from the 14th to the 20th centuries, including unique Expressionist and Neoclassical structures.
